Play Capybara Clicker, the engaging idle game in which you improve your capybara inhabitants by way of strategic clicking and upgrades. Start your capybara empire these days! No registration is needed! You'll be able to start playing our games unblocked instantly without creating an account or furnishing any particular details. https://erickjmpqt.thekatyblog.com/33321230/considerations-to-know-about-best-casual-online-games